package org.roosster.api;

import org.apache.commons.httpclient.HttpClient;
import org.apache.commons.httpclient.methods.*;

import org.roosster.RoossterTestCase;

/**
 *
 * @author <a href="mailto:benjamin@roosster.org">Benjamin Reitzammer</a> 
 */
public class TestApi extends RoossterTestCase {
    protected HttpClient client = null;

    protected StringRequestEntity putRequestBody = null;
    protected StringRequestEntity postRequestBody = null;

    /**
     * 
     */
    public void setUp() throws Exception {
        client = new HttpClient();

        putRequestBody = new StringRequestEntity(TEST_ENTRYXML, "text/xml", "UTF-8");
        postRequestBody = new StringRequestEntity(TEST_ENTRYXML_EMPTY, "text/xml", "UTF-8");
    }

    /**
     * 
     */
    public void testApi() throws Exception {
        // FIRST ADD URL
        System.out.println("Trying to POST '" + TEST_URL + "' as a new entry to " + API_ENDPOINT);

        PostMethod post = new PostMethod(API_ENDPOINT + "?force=true");
        post.setRequestEntity(postRequestBody);

        int statusCode = client.executeMethod(post);

        assertEquals("POST to " + TEST_URL + " failed", 200, statusCode);

        logMethodResponse(post);

        // ... THEN GET IT
        System.out.println("Trying to GET '" + TEST_URL + "' as a new entry to " + API_ENDPOINT);

        GetMethod get = new GetMethod(API_ENDPOINT + "/entry?url=" + TEST_URL);
        statusCode = client.executeMethod(get);

        assertEquals("GET from " + TEST_URL + " failed", 200, statusCode);

        logMethodResponse(get);

        // ... THEN UPDATE IT
        System.out.println("Trying to PUT '" + TEST_URL + "' as a new entry to " + API_ENDPOINT);

        PutMethod put = new PutMethod(API_ENDPOINT);
        put.setRequestEntity(putRequestBody);

        statusCode = client.executeMethod(put);

        assertEquals("PUT to " + TEST_URL + " failed", 200, statusCode);

        logMethodResponse(put);

        // ... THEN GET IT AGAIN
        System.out.println("Trying to GET '" + TEST_URL + "' as a new entry to " + API_ENDPOINT);

        get = new GetMethod(API_ENDPOINT + "/entry?url=" + TEST_URL);

        statusCode = client.executeMethod(get);

        assertEquals("GET from " + TEST_URL + " failed", 200, statusCode);

        logMethodResponse(get);

        // ... AND DELETE IT AGAIN
        System.out.println("Trying to DELETE '" + TEST_URL + "' as a new entry to " + API_ENDPOINT);

        DeleteMethod del = new DeleteMethod(API_ENDPOINT + "?url=" + TEST_URL);

        statusCode = client.executeMethod(del);

        assertEquals("GET from " + TEST_URL + " failed", 200, statusCode);

        logMethodResponse(get);

        // ... THEN GET IT AGAIN
        System.out.println("Trying to GET '" + TEST_URL + "' as a new entry to " + API_ENDPOINT);

        get = new GetMethod(API_ENDPOINT + "/entry?url=" + TEST_URL);

        statusCode = client.executeMethod(get);

        assertEquals("GET from " + TEST_URL + " failed", 200, statusCode);

        logMethodResponse(get);

    }

}
